For those of you who don't know, here's the skinny:

1997 Ford Ranger Splash Extended Cab
-Toreador Red/Prairie Tan
-A/C
-Power Steering
-Power Brakes with 4-wheel ABS option
-AM/FM/Cassette with Premium Sound
-3.55 Trac-Lok 8.8" axle
-Sliding rear window
-Interval wipers
-Factory Bed Liner & Rails
-Splash performance suspension
-Cloth bucket seats
-Center console
-Rear jump seats
-11,000 miles on body/chassis
-Never any body or frame damage of any kind.

Engine:
-Fuel Injected 1995 Ford Mustang Cobra 5.0L from Alternative Auto Performance (Livonia, MI)
-8 PSI Kenne-Bell Autorotor supercharger (I've seen 10 PSI on the gauge)
-30 lb.-hr. fuel injectors
-75mm Pro-M mass air flow sensor
-9" conical K&N air filter
-Custom 3.5" stainless steel air intake to throttle body.
-65mm Ford Motorsport SN95 throttle body
-Ported lower GT-40/Cobra intake
-1.7 Roller rockers
-Billet aluminum fuel pressure regulator
-255 LPH in-tank fuel pump with custom braided stainless fuel lines to fuel rail
-High-output 130 AMP alternator
-High-volume oil pump
-Remote oil filter with -10 braided stainless line and aluminum fittings
-10 pass stacked plate Setrab oil cooler behind screened bumper opening
-HD radiator
-180 degree thermostat (cruises at 170-180 degrees, never goes above 195--NEVER)
-Stainless steel CoolFlex radiator hoses with aluminum brackets
-Dual 12" pusher fans with thermostatic control and manual override
-Custom stainless steel exhaust headers
-Complete true dual 2.5" T-304 stainless exhaust system with 2.5" catalytic converters. 100% TIG welded. Polished stainless steel angle cut tips (like a Mustang LX) exiting under passenger side rear bumper.
-A9L EEC from 1993 Ford Mustang 5.0L
-Custom computer chip
-A-pillar mounted Autometer mechanical Boost & Coolant Temperature gauges with matching green backlighting.


Drivetrain:
-Tremec 3550 5-speed transmission with mid-shift kit for factory shifter location
-Ford Motorsport HD clutch and pressure plate
-McLeod hydraulic throwout bearing
-Custom chromoly steel shifter with leather Mustang Cobra shift knob. Retains factory console & shifter boot.
-HD Ford Ranger 4x4 steel driveshaft.
-3.55 gears in factory 8.8" Trac-Lok differential

Electronics:
-All new sensors, wiring & harnesses from Ford Motorsport
-Factory connectors & ports retained for easy service
-All gauges 100% functional, including temperature & electronic speedometer
-Read trouble codes using factory Check Engine light or ALDL diagnostic port located in the engine compartment.

Miscellaneous:
-Explorer "V8" Badges on front fenders
-Includes some additional parts, including Kenne-Bell Boost-A-Pump (not needed unless you want more boost), Wilwood clutch master cylinder (to reduce clutch pedal effort if desired)
